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ho Location

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ho is conveniently situated in the bustling Taito ward of Tokyo, a district renowned for its unique blend of traditional culture and modern entertainment. Located at 東京都台東区上野3-2-5, 東京都, 台東区, 関東, 日本, the hotel offers excellent accessibility, being just a short walk from the Suehirocho Station on the Tokyo Metro Ginza Line and Akihabara Station, a major hub for JR and Tokyo Metro lines. This prime location places you at the nexus of convenience, with the city center easily reachable within minutes. The atmosphere surrounding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ho is electric, especially for fans of anime, manga, and electronics, given its proximity to the world-famous Akihabara Electric Town. Despite the lively surroundings, the hotel provides a peaceful retreat after a day of exploration.

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ho Nearby Attractions and Activities

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ho is perfectly positioned to explore the vibrant attractions of Taito and surrounding Tokyo areas.
  • Akihabara Electric Town:

    Just steps away, this world-famous district is a paradise for electronics, anime, manga, and gaming enthusiasts.
  • Kanda Myojin Shrine:

    A historic and colorful shrine, popular for its blessings and its connection to technology and anime culture.
  • Ueno Park:

    A large public park home to several museums, a zoo, and beautiful cherry blossom spots in season.
  • Tokyo National Museum:

    Located within Ueno Park, it houses an extensive collection of Japanese art and artifacts.
  • Ameya-Yokocho Market (Ameyoko):

    A bustling street market near Ueno Station, offering a wide variety of goods from fresh produce to clothing.

How to Get to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ho from the Airport

Getting to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ho from the airport is straightforward, with several convenient options available.
  • Narita International Airport (NRT):

    • Narita Express Train:

      Take the Narita Express to Tokyo Station, then transfer to the JR Yamanote Line or Keihin-Tohoku Line to Akihabara Station. The journey takes approximately 60-75 minutes and costs around 3,000-3,500 PHP.
    • Limousine Bus:

      Direct Limousine Buses operate from Narita Airport to major hotels and stations in Tokyo, including those near Akihabara. This option is convenient but can take longer depending on traffic, typically 70-90 minutes, with prices around 1,500-2,000 PHP.
    • Taxi/Ride-hailing Service:

      A taxi or ride-hailing service from Narita Airport to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ho is the most direct but also the most expensive option, potentially costing 15,000-20,000 PHP and taking 60-90 minutes.
  • Haneda Airport (HND):

    • Keikyu Line/Tokyo Monorail:

      Take the Keikyu Line or Tokyo Monorail to Hamamatsucho Station, then transfer to the JR Yamanote Line or Keihin-Tohoku Line to Akihabara Station. This journey takes about 30-45 minutes and costs around 800-1,200 PHP.
    • Limousine Bus:

      Similar to Narita, Limousine Buses are available from Haneda Airport to various points in Tokyo. The travel time is around 30-50 minutes, with prices around 800-1,200 PHP.
    • Taxi/Ride-hailing Service:

      A taxi or ride-hailing service from Haneda Airport will take approximately 20-40 minutes depending on traffic and cost around 4,000-6,000 PHP.
  • Hotel Airport Transfer Service:

    Super Hotel Akihabara-Suehirocho does not offer a dedicated private airport transfer service. However, you can arrange for airport transfer services through third-party providers or use readily available public transport and taxis.
